Ana Maria
Redondo
Jan 7, 1930 — Mar 10, 2023
Ana Redondo, a loving and devoted mother, grandmother, sister, and aunt, peacefully passed away in hospice on March 10, 2023, at the age of 93. Despite facing numerous health struggles throughout her life, Ana never lost her fighting spirit. Recently, she bravely battled through surgery and rehabilitation following a fall, and it appeared as though she may pull through yet again. However, after spending 10 days in the hospital and one day in hospice care, doctors were unable to do anything further to alleviate her suffering.
Ana was a profoundly caring and selfless person. She devoted her life to her family and church always putting their needs before her own.
Born in Ecuador on January 7, 1930, Ana immigrated to New York in 1963 with her immediate family. She established roots in Queens, New York, where she owned her own home and held her only job as an Import/Export textile supervisor at Hearst Celanese. She worked tirelessly until her retirement in 1992, at the age of 62.
Ana is survived by her daughter, Diana Redondo McDonald, and son-in-law Robert McDonald, as well as her beloved granddaughters Ashley Kristine Hunter, (Tradd Hunter-Husband), Alana Marie McDonald, Amanda Bilodeau, (Andrew Bilodeau-Husband), Alexandra McDonald, great-grandchildren Penelope Grace, Camila and Brody.
Additionally, she leaves behind sisters Elsa Vitek, Maggie Rappa, Yolonda Ruiz, and Leonor Rivera, as well as numerous nieces and nephews. She was preceded in death by her cherished brother, Carlos Borja.
She will forever be missed, but in the midst of our grief, we find solace in the knowledge that Ana is no longer in pain, and that she has been reunited with loved ones who have passed before her. A Celebration of Life will be held in her honor on April 22, 2023, at St. Robert Bellarmine Roman Catholic Church, located at 56-15 213th St., Bayside, NY 11364, beginning at 9:30 a.m.
In lieu of flowers, donations can be made to Meals on Wheels, a charitable organization close to Ana's heart.
